Suitable areas of application • Water and water vapor • Concentrated acids (e.g. nitric acid 60%) • Amines (e.g. ethylenediamine) • Organic acids (e.g. acetic acid) • Ketones (e.g. methyl-ethyl-ketone) • Alkaline solutions (e.g. sodium-hydroxide, potassium- hydroxide) • Organic solvents (e.g. methanol) • Aroma concentrates Simriz® replaces elastomers such as EPDM or FKM when their temperature and media resistance can no longer cope with the demands of the application area, but rubber- elastic behavior is imperative. For example, hygienic design requirements in terms of absence of dead space and good cleanability only leave a minimal margin to the sealing element. Thermal expansion and media swelling must be as small as possible here. Under these stricter requirements with regard to purity and extreme media resistance, even in CIP/SIP processes and at temperatures above +150 °C (+302 °F), Simriz® delivers a high performance that is widely acknowledged in the market. Simriz®in the chemical and pharmaceutical industries Simriz® can be used in almost all chemicals. Exceptions are the compounds of the alkali metals. Simriz® perfluoroelastomers (FFKM) are produced using special perfluorinated, completely hydrogen-free mon- omers, with appropriate compounding and processing techniques. They represent the high-end solution in ma- terials technology. Simriz® is characterized by a broad chemical resistance similar to that of PTFE, combined with the rubber-elastic properties of an elastomer. General properties Thanks to FFKM, utmost temperature and media resistance is not reserved only to PTFE materials with a degree of fluor- ination of 76%. The operating conditions are limited when using PTFE due to its tendency to cold flow and lack of elas- ticity. At high pressures and many changes in temperature, pure PTFE seals prove to be unsuitable. Simriz®, on the other hand, combines almost the identical universal resistance of PTFE with the elastic advantages of elastomers. Therefore, with Simriz® many sealing problems can be solved better and easier. Simriz® also shows very reliable properties in static and dynamic applications, as well as in frequent temperature changes and aggressive media. In addition, Simriz® as FFKM offers the highest degree of fluorination among elastomers. The high bond ener- gy between carbon and fluorine atoms enables excellent resistance to a variety of chemicals with different reac- tive functional groups and the use in polar and non-polar media, even at high concentrations and temperatures. In addition, the temperature stability with approximately –10 °C to +325 °C (+14 °F to +617 °F) is extraordinarily compre- hensive for an elastomer. SIMRIZ® Elastomeric materials 42
